Tips for Energy-Efficient Heating

Insulation Techniques

Proper insulation is fundamental to retaining warmth during cooler months and reducing heating demands. In Daphne, where mild winters still require effective heating, upgrading insulation in key areas is essential:

    Attic Insulation: Ensure your attic has sufficient insulation levels to prevent heat loss through the roof. Materials such as spray foam provide superior air sealing compared to traditional fiberglass. Wall Insulation: Thickening or replacing wall insulation helps maintain interior temperature stability by minimizing thermal bridging. Crawl Space Insulation: Sealing and insulating crawl spaces protect against moisture infiltration and cold air drafts.

Each type of insulation offers specific pros and cons based on cost, R-value, and installation ease, so selecting the right materials tailored to your home’s structure will maximize heating efficiency.

HVAC System Optimization

Your furnace or heat pump should operate efficiently to conserve energy. Regular upkeep enhances performance and energy savings:

    Schedule annual furnace maintenance including filter changes, burner cleaning, and thermostat calibration. Consider upgrading to a heat pump, which provides both heating and cooling with greater energy efficiency suitable for Daphne’s climate. Implement zone control systems to heat only occupied rooms, avoiding wasted energy in unused spaces.

Optimizing your HVAC system aligns mechanical efficiency with your household’s actual heating needs, improving energy performance across the board.

Smart Thermostats and Controls

Installing programmable or smart thermostats can significantly reduce energy waste while maintaining comfort. These devices learn your schedule, adjust settings automatically, and can be controlled remotely via smartphone:

    Set temperature setbacks during sleeping hours or when away from home to reduce heating bills without sacrificing comfort. Integrate with HVAC system alerts to remind you of necessary maintenance or filter replacements.

Such intelligent controls empower homeowners to manage energy use proactively and adapt to changing weather or occupancy conditions easily.

Tips for Energy-Efficient Cooling

Duct Sealing and Maintenance

Leaky or poorly insulated ducts cause substantial cooling losses. Ensuring proper duct sealing improves system efficiency and indoor air quality:

    Inspect all visible ducts for leaks, cracks, or disconnected joints. Seal leaks using mastic sealant or specialized foil tape rather than standard duct tape. Insulate ducts running through unconditioned spaces to minimize heat gain.

A well-maintained duct system supports uniform cooling and reduces strain on your air conditioner.

Use of Energy-Efficient Appliances

Choosing Energy Star-rated appliances and upgrading windows are powerful steps for reducing cooling loads:

    Install energy-efficient air conditioners designed to consume less electricity and provide better humidity control. Replace old single-pane windows with double-pane or low-emissivity (low-e) models to reflect heat and improve insulation.

These upgrades complement cooling systems by keeping warm air out and cool air in.

Alternative Cooling Methods

Incorporating passive and supplemental cooling methods can further reduce dependence on mechanical air conditioning:

    Use ceiling fans to circulate air and enhance perceived comfort without large energy costs. Plant shade trees strategically around the home to block direct sunlight and reduce solar heat gain. Apply window films that reduce ultraviolet rays and infrared heat entering your dwelling.

Combining these strategies with your central cooling system results in holistic climate control, tailored to Daphne’s hot summers.

Regular Maintenance for HVAC Systems

Routine HVAC maintenance ensures optimal operation and longer system lifespan:

    Replace or clean air filters every 1-3 months to maintain airflow and indoor air quality. Check and clean condenser coils on your air conditioner annually. Inspect humidifiers, dehumidifiers, and ventilation components built into your system for proper function.

Preventive care avoids costly repairs, supports energy efficiency, and keeps indoor humidity at comfortable levels.

Conducting an Energy Audit

Performing a home energy audit is a powerful way to identify specific areas where energy is wasted and opportunities to enhance efficiency exist:

    Evaluate your building envelope including insulation, windows, doors, and duct systems. Use tools like blower door tests and infrared cameras to detect air leaks and thermal irregularities. Create a prioritized retrofit plan that balances immediate fixes and long-term investments.

DIY checklists combined with professional audits offer insight to guide renovations and system upgrades aligned with your energy goals.
